We are happy to release so-needed update to our first game – Mars Miner. It fixes pretty common bug connected with Zip.dll library we were using – which was stopping a lot of players from trying our game, specially on newer OS like Windows 7 or Windows XP 64 bit.
Also, it adds a couple of smaller balance and misc changes.
History of Mars Miner updates:
1.2.0: - Zip.dll startup error should be fixed now – download New version if you had that error
- Game Protection mechanism was changed – all license owners should contact us to get new keys
- Difficulty balance changes and other small fixes
1.1.0: - New sound tracks by Mad-Tek and Takomo
- Difficulty balance changes, it should be easier and more fun to play now
- Other small fixes
1.0.8
- Reworked sound engine
- Additional music themes
- Story mode Awards and small balance changes
- Survival is more dynamical now
- Smaller game size, but more content
1.0.6:
- Random hanging in full-screen mode. Score computation’s are faster now in Survival mode

We are preparing renovated version of FDMpro.com for Seedcamp‘s final and I’m working over new stadium graphics.
Here are first tests (GIF animation):
The hardest part was to slice and prepare stadium model for rendering into layers. Also, we need to find some way to automate rendering process using scripts.

At last I have some free time to prepare and upload my animation online.
It’s CG music video for song “He is Hacker” of Ukrainian music band “Bottle Green”. Leader of the band is the friend of mine so I created this animation almost for free in my spare time.
You can download Medium-resolution DivX video here:
Almost everything was done by me during last year and rendered in December. Final cut with some post-fx was done in January of 2008 with help of my friend Vadim.
